NCIS Los Angeles star LL Cool J and current Billboard chart-topper Ke$ha are among the first presenters to be announced for this year's Grammy Awards.
Joined by Justin Bieber, Norah Jones, Ricky Martin, Kristen Bell, Jeff Bridges, Miley Cyrus, Josh Duhamel, the Jonas Brothers, Carlos Santana and Ringo Starr, LL Cool J and Ke$ha will reveal winners in categories including Record of the Year, Best R&B Album, and Best Pop Vocal Collaboration.
As previously reported, performers/nominees Beyoncé, the Black Eyed Peas, Bon Jovi, the Dave Matthews Band, Green Day, Lady Antebellum, Lady Gaga, Maxwell, P!nk, Taylor Swift, and the Zac Brown Band are all due to take the stage.
The 52nd Annual Grammy Awards air live Sunday, Jan. 31, from the STAPLES Center in Los Angeles and will be broadcast in HDTV and 5.1 Surround Sound on the CBS Television Network from 8 – 11:30 p.m. (ET/PT).
